Artifacts have been recently proposed as first-class abstractions to model and engineer general-purpose computational environments for mul- tiagent systems. In this paper, we consider the design and development of an infrastructure called CArtAgO, directly supporting the artifact notion for the engineering of multiagent applications. We first propose an abstract model of the infrastructure, and then describe an implementation prototype of it. |
